Two Rockies summits, 9.5 hours, and a baptism by Grande Mountain's notorious powerline descent.
The Near Death Marathon is a 41.3km course covering the first two legs of the full Canadian Death Race, taking runners from downtown Grande Cache along quad trails past Grande Cache Lake and Peavine Lake, then up and over both Flood Mountain and Grande Mountain in a grueling double-summit challenge. The course returns to the Start/Finish in Grande Cache via the infamous Grande Mountain powerline descent — steep, rocky, and unforgiving. With 1,775m of elevation gain and a 9.5-hour cutoff, this is a serious race in its own right and serves as a challenging preview of the full Death Race experience.

Dogs are not permitted on the race course. Dogs are welcome at the venue and camping areas but must be kept on a leash at all times.
Tent City at MD Greenview (baseball field, 104 Ave + Memorial Drive). $50 weekend pass for tents and RVs, first-come first-served. Includes shower access at the Grande Cache Recreation Centre. Check-in Thu-Sat, check-out Mon by noon. Contact: Grande Cache Tourism 780-827-3300.

August weather in the Canadian Rockies can include intense heat, rain, and sudden cold — dress in layers
